What's the solution to the Worldstone puzzle in the map room? The book says something about "darkness ruling the old city without challenge", but every combination that involves darkness and the city doesn't work. Help!
|
||
|
|
26-05-2005, 08:59 AM | #39 | ||
|
Quote:
But everywhere else you have to follow every clue. The sunstone has to be aligned the same in every puzzle, just as the moonstone. So all you have to do is to align the worldstone relative to the moon and sunstone's position in the previous puzzles. |
